11 ejercicios después de clase

# 一: Tarea de hoy: 
# 1, escriba una herramienta de copia de archivos
sorce_file = input ('ruta del archivo fuente'). Strip ()
dist_file = input ('ruta del archivo de destino'). Strip ()
con open (r '{}'. format (sorce_file), mode = 'w', encoding = 'utf-8') como f1, \
open (r '{}'. format (dist_file), mode = 'r', encoding = 'utf-8') como f2:
para la línea en f2:
f1.write (línea)



# 2. Escriba un programa de inicio de sesión, la contraseña de la cuenta proviene del
nombre del archivo = input ('input user name'). strip ()
psd = input ('input password'). strip ()
con open ('info.txt', mode = 'r', encoding = 'utf-8') como info_f:
para línea en info_f:
nombre de usuario, userpsd = line.strip (). split (':')
if username == name and userpsd == psd:
print ('Inicio de sesión exitoso')
break
else:
print ('Error de inicio de sesión')

# 3, escriba un programa de registro, la contraseña de la cuenta se almacena en el archivo
reg_name = input ('create user name')
reg_psd = input ('input password')
con open ('reg.txt', mode = 'a', encoding = ' utf-8 ') como rg_f:
rg_f.write (' {}: {} \ n'.format (reg_name, reg_psd))
 
# 一: Tarea de hoy: 
# 1, escriba una herramienta de copia de archivos
sorce_file = input ('ruta del archivo fuente'). Strip ()
dist_file = input ('ruta del archivo de destino'). Strip ()
con open (r '{}'. format (sorce_file), mode = 'w', encoding = 'utf-8') como f1, \
open (r '{}'. format (dist_file), mode = 'r', encoding = 'utf-8') como f2:
para la línea en f2:
f1.write (línea)



# 2. Escriba un programa de inicio de sesión, la contraseña de la cuenta proviene del
nombre del archivo = input ('input user name'). strip ()
psd = input ('input password'). strip ()
con open ('info.txt', mode = 'r', encoding = 'utf-8') como info_f:
para línea en info_f:
nombre de usuario, userpsd = line.strip (). split (':')
if username == name and userpsd == psd:
print ('Inicio de sesión exitoso')
break
else:
print ('Error de inicio de sesión')

# 3, escriba un programa de registro, la contraseña de la cuenta se almacena en el archivo
reg_name = input ('create user name')
reg_psd = input ('input password')
con open ('reg.txt', mode = 'a', encoding = ' utf-8 ') como rg_f:
rg_f.write (' {}: {} \ n'.format (reg_name, reg_psd))

Supongo que te gusta

Origin www.cnblogs.com/baozai168/p/12729033.html
Recomendado
Clasificación